Her family consists of a father who stitches garments for a living, a mother who takes care of the home. One day, Bhoomika was a college student with a dream. Next, she was a patient.

In the months that followed, Bhoomika went through five rounds of chemotherapy and several blood transfusions, her body repeatedly breaking down and being rebuilt, session after session. Each cycle brought exhaustion, nausea, and uncertainty. There were no surgeries, no shortcuts. Just the slow, brutal process of trying to outlast a disease that moves fast.

She is currently at home, resting between treatments. But resting is not the same as recovering, not yet. The doctors at HCG Hospital have made it clear: the only real path forward is a bone marrow transplant, a procedure where her damaged blood-producing cells are wiped out and replaced with healthy ones from a donor. Her father has stepped up to be that donor. A garment factory worker earning ₹15,000 a month, he is giving her the only thing money cannot buy, his bone marrow, his cells, his chance.

But the procedure itself costs far more than this family has ever seen. The transplant, the hospital stay, the medications that follow, it adds up to a number that feels impossible when you are calculating it against a monthly salary of fifteen thousand rupees. Bhoomika's mother, a homemaker, watches all of this from the edges, holding the household together with whatever is left.
Bhoomika is their only child. She is the whole dream, all of it, resting in one person.

She hasn't stopped thinking about code. About the career she was building. About the projects she wants to complete. That stubbornness, the quiet refusal to let go of what she loves, is perhaps the most human thing about her story. She is not just fighting to survive. She is fighting to go back.

Crowdfunding is the practice of raising money for a social cause or project or venture by collecting small contributions from a large number of people, typically via the Internet.
Crowdfunding helps anyone create an online fundraiser for his/her needs and seek help from people across the globe.
